Transaction ac50370754edf900522a601ce28b46685cf2f9dda3fa2a6d695f92db272957de
1 Input
1 Output
-
ac50370754edf900522a601ce28b46685cf2f9dda3fa2a6d695f92db272957de:0
- value
- 596396
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 678a67e53fd89a062d4a807ef09966e30c9c78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ASUQNAuTHtyZHoDYnfTuk3gUtH5zw9h3A